May 2025 - Apr 2026St Andrews Close area has the 4th highest crime rate of 24 local areas in Downham Villages , and the 76th highest crime rate of 245 local areas in East Cambridgeshire .
At least one of the neighbouring streets has high or very high crime levels. However, overall crime around this postcode is more mixed, with some nearby areas experiencing lower crime.
The overall crime rate in the area around St Andrews Close (CB6 2QX) in the last 12 months was 70.7 per 1,000 residents and was 86.2% higher than the Downham Villages average (38.0 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Anti-social behaviour with 15 offences recorded. The least common crime was Burglary with 1 case , unchanged from 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Vehicle crime ( 100.0% YoY). Other major crime categories were broadly unchanged compared to 2025.
Violent crimes totalled 18 (≈ 27.1 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were rising ( 20.0%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has rising ( 44.2%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around St Andrews Close (CB6 2QX), the main crime hotspot is near Saffron Piece. Police recorded 20 crimes here, including 14 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
